Wait, what's happening? I thought Crimea already became a part of Russia?


Crimea is technically part of Russia (although nobody but Russia and Crimea considers it to be legit) but now the Eastern part of Ukraine, the Russian side, are protesting themselves in multiple cities. Armed gunmen have taken key buildings in some of the cities (some say they are Russian soldiers/Russian sponsored) and because of this, the Ukrainian army sent in "anti-terrorist" squads to quell the defiance. It was unsuccessful, some soldiers defecting, some of them being disarmed by the armed gunmen and sent back and yesterday a small clash broke out where 2 helicopters were shot down and a few people killed/wounded. Pro-Kiev supporters set up a camp at Odessa in Eastern Ukraine and were met with violence from pro-Russians, I think someone was wounded. In retaliation, the pro-Kiev supporters threw molotovs at a pro-Russian occupied building which ended up burning down and killing 38 people inside of it. 4-7 pro-Kiev supporters were also shot in the chaos.
